Photo Richard Christensen Olympic loans arrive: The first 14 LRV's of a total of 29 have been shipped by rail from Dallas DART to Salt Lake City's TRAX. The remainder will arrive in November, The 29 cars will supplement TRAX's 33 car fleet during the winter Olympics from February 3 through February 26, 2002. The DART cars will retain their bright yellow livery. They seat 76 compared to the TRAX cars at 64. The UTA is also receiving 900 buses on loan from transit systems nationwide during the Olympics.

The cars are being tested on the north/south TRAX line. Testing will take about two weeks. The cars have all been tested previously in Dallas, but testing on arrival will ensure that none of the cars were damaged in transit and check for any incompatability problems.

It is expected that the TRAX system will open its new LRT line to the University on December 15, 2001.
